Create completion records from new webhook course reports

Your CE completions arrive as raw webhooks, leaving licensing teams without auditable records. It creates clean completion records so coordinators can file reports same day.

Create completion records from new webhook course reports

Overview

Incoming completion webhooks often land as fragmented payloads, forcing manual re-entry and delaying state reporting. This flow turns those webhooks into tidy, auditable completion records and posts status back to reporting endpoints so licensing coordinators can reconcile and file same day.

Create completion records from new webhook course reports